## Formula sandbox tuning

User-supplied formulas in Gridmoor execute inside a restricted interpreter with hard ceilings on time, memory, and call depth. Reviewers should confirm any change to these ceilings is justified in the PR description, since raising them widens the abuse surface. Defaults were chosen from production traces. The current limits are as follows.

limits module of tafog-fawip:
WEIGHTS = {
    "julix": 57,
    "lamys": 992,
    "kasvan": 209,
    "quenok": 750,
    "alddor": 259,
    "oliath": 1009,
    "wenix": 815,
}

## Approvals: Websocket Reconnect Fix

This page tracks sign-off for the patch addressing the reconnect storm in the Pondbridge gateway, where dropped websocket sessions retried without backoff and overwhelmed the edge nodes. The fix adds jittered exponential backoff and caps concurrent reconnect attempts per client. QA has verified behavior under simulated network flaps, and load testing passed on staging. Before we schedule the rollout, we need one final approval per our change policy. The approver responsible for this change is named below.

account owner for tawip-kahop: Oliok Jorix Ulaath Quenok

## Ticket: Bloomgate Misconfiguration in Staging

The Bloomgate filter fronting the Cairnstore KV cluster is rejecting valid keys because staging was deployed without the filter seed variables. False-negative rate hit 12%. Reviewer: please verify the corrected env file sets `BLOOMGATE_BITS` and `BLOOMGATE_HASHES`, then includes the store's access secret on the next line.

secret setting of tahof-kajep: LEDGER_TOKEN29=03c4e4b922dd54de02b24296fd79c

## Configuration — Rebuilder

Rebuilder handles incremental rebuilds for the Fernvale docs site. Only changed pages recompile; full rebuilds require REBUILD_FORCE=1. Set REBUILD_CONCURRENCY=4 on standard nodes, 8 on the large pool. Cache lives at REBUILD_CACHE_DIR; never point it at tmpfs. Publishing to the Fernvale CDN needs an auth token, set on the line below in the env file.

vault entry, yahif-yajep: COURIER_KEY29=b802bdf8034096b65a51c6ba5abe2